re: Ceramic coating.  Was this an original component, or was it made and failed?  Are you running a standard factory exhaust, or have you changed something in the run of the system?
 
If you can stand the wait, repair (or replace) the cracked component, then fit it up and run it for a few thousand k's.  Remove and inspect, if it's still good then coat it. Saves the heartbreak of "Oh, my very sexy ceramic coated exhaust has cracked in the same place as last time . . ."

kameleon
Is the manifold braced Cjay?
 
Steampipe is generally alot more robust and resistant to cracking.




It is steam pipe and its not braced but the issue (we think) was the weld and weight of the wastegate pipe and wastegate.
 
I have gone a smaller wastegate now Turbosmart CompGate45 compared to an HKS 60mm which is a significant weight change.  I cant believe how responsive the car is now.
